The Journal of Anatomy , abbreviated J. Anat. , Is a scientific journal published by Wiley-Blackwell-Verlag on behalf of the Anatomical Society . The journal was founded in 1867 under the name Journal of Anatomy and Physiology . In 1916 the name was shortened to Journal of Anatomy . It appears monthly. Works from the field of anatomy are published.

The impact factor in 2014 was 2.097. According to the statistics of the ISI Web of Knowledge , the journal with this impact factor ranks sixth out of 20 journals in the anatomy and morphology category.
